TRIVEDI, NANDINI, and J. K. JAIN. "NUMERICAL STUDY OF JASTROW-SLATER TRIAL STATES FOR THE FRACTIONAL QUANTUM HALL EFFECT." Modern Physics Letters B 05, no. 07 (1991): 503–10. http://dx.doi.org/10.1142/s0217984991000599.

Full text
Abstract:
We study the recently proposed trial states for the fractional quantum Hall effect, which are constructed by multiplying the wavefunction for filled Landau levels with Jastrow correlation factors. In spite of the essential use of higher Landau levels, we demonstrate the validity of the variational states using Monte Carlo methods by showing that the Jastrow factors ensure (i) these states lie predominantly in the lowest Landau level and (ii) they have very low interaction energies.

Freeman Michael. "Terrorism and Organized Crime." In NATO Science for Peace and Security Series - E: Human and Societal Dynamics. IOS Press, 2008. https://doi.org/10.3233/978-1-58603-892-2-95.

Full text
Abstract:
The nexus of organized crime and terrorism is complex and an increasingly important issue for policy makers. Frequently, terrorist groups and organized crime look much alike structurally and engage in similar activities, yet there are also some crucial differences in their acceptance of risk, their motivating ideology, and their use of violence, for example. Furthermore, terrorist and criminal groups often work together and these alliances have a force multiplying effect in terms of the dangers they might pose to the state.

Seo, Ki-Wan, Jin-Ha Hwang, and Yun-Jae Kim. "Numerical Method to Determine Fracture Toughness Under Hydrogen Environment From Small Punch Test Data and Experimental Validation." In ASME 2022 Pressure Vessels & Piping Conference. American Society of Mechanical Engineers, 2022. http://dx.doi.org/10.1115/pvp2022-84687.

Full text
Abstract:
Abstract This paper proposes a simple method to predict the fracture toughness of hydrogen-embrittled material using a hydrogen-embrittlement constant. The effect of hydrogen-embrittlement on fracture strain can be quantified via hydrogen-embrittlement constant, and it can be obtained by simulating small punch test in hydrogen. The fracture toughness of hydrogen-embrittled material can be simply estimated by multiplying the constant on fracture toughness of the un-embrittled material. The result of estimation shows good agreement with the published experimental data.

Terada-Hagiwara, Akiko, Yothin Jinjarak, Huanhuan Zheng, and Hanmin Dong. : Local Fiscal Multipliers in the People’s Republic of China: What Have We Learned? Asian Development Bank, 2024. https://doi.org/10.22617/wps240533-2.

Full text
Abstract:
This paper assesses the impact of local government spending on provincial outputs in the People's Republic of China. Public investment in science and technology has multiplying effects on output, which benefits long-term productivity. If excessive, fiscal deficits and public debt can weaken the benefits of expansionary policies. Differentiating the impact of specific spending components and the economic environment on the provincial output and local fiscal conditions remains challenging. Future research can explore this further with more disaggregated administrative project-level data.
